Factors Influencing Roof Covering Expenses



When you're thinking about a brand-new roofing, several variables can influence the overall expense. Initially, the dimension of your roofing system plays an essential role. Bigger roofings require even more materials and labor, driving up costs.

Next off, the complexity of your roof's design matters. If your roof has numerous inclines, valleys, or distinct attributes, setup can become much more challenging and costly.

Labor expenses likewise differ based upon your location and the availability of skilled workers. Areas with greater need for roofing solutions commonly see boosted labor prices.

Furthermore, the timing of your project can impact prices, as roof covering firms might use lower prices throughout the offseason.

Another crucial variable is the condition of your existing roofing system. If you require to remove old materials or make repair work prior to mounting a brand-new roofing, those included tasks will certainly boost your total budget.

Lastly, your selection of roof can influence prices, as some choices may call for customized setup strategies.

Comprehending these variables helps you prepare for the monetary dedication of a new roofing system. By being informed, you can make better decisions that straighten with your spending plan and lasting goals for your home.

Understanding Labor Expenditures



Labor expenses can significantly influence the total price of your roofing project. When you work with a specialist, you're not simply paying for their time; you're likewise covering their competence and the abilities of their staff. Commonly, labor expenses can represent 60% to 70% of your complete roof expenditures, so understanding these costs is essential.

Various factors affect labor expenditures. The complexity of your roofing plays a big role-- steeper roofing systems or those with several facets require even more ability and time, causing higher labor prices.

Geographic location issues as well; professionals in metropolitan areas commonly bill more because of higher demand and living costs.


It's likewise essential to think about the contractor's experience and online reputation. While you might find less expensive options, opting for a trusted contractor can save you cash in the future by decreasing the risk of blunders and making certain quality workmanship.

When you get quotes, make certain to break down the expenses to see how much is alloted for labor. By doing this, you'll have a more clear image and can spending plan accordingly, guaranteeing your roofing task stays on track financially.
